Bluedrop has partnered with SkyAlyne, the prime contractor, on the Future Aircrew Training (FAcT) Program for the Government of Canada. This is Canada’s next generation pilot and aircrew training program for the Royal Canadian Air Force (RCAF).
The FAcT Program will transform how the RCAF trains its next generation of pilots and rear crew. Combining live flying, advanced simulations, and classroom learning, this long-term program ensures aircrew are fully prepared for future operations.
As part of the SkyAlyne Team, Bluedrop is responsible for the development and implementation of the courseware training, on-going maintenance and support of the courseware, and much more!
